There's bound to be ML> something that can be addressed with regards to that; I *seriously* ML> doubt that Squish is at fault. I don't believe it has anything to do with the MSGID. If Squish had a problem with this kind of MSGID lines, it would be clearly Squish's fault. But I think it's unlikely, because this problem would be already known for a long time (and most likely fixed). MSGID are just IDs for dupe checking and message linking, not for figuring out the zone number or address. or fixing the problem we have to know the real cause of the problem. Have you inspected the raw packets before tossing? * Origin: kakistocracy (2:280/464.47) .
